What Defines a Reliable Online Poker Platform?
Security and Fairness
First and foremost, any reputable online poker site must prioritize security and fairness. Look for licenses from recognized authorities such as the Malta Gaming Authority (MGA) or the UK Gambling Commission, which enforce strict standards for operator conduct and game fairness. Platforms should employ SSL encryption to protect your personal and financial data, ensuring that your information remains confidential. Additionally, fair play is guaranteed through the use of certified random number generators (RNGs), which ensure that game outcomes are genuinely random and not manipulated.

Bonuses and Promotions in Online Poker
Welcome Bonuses and Loyalty Programs
Many online poker platforms offer attractive bonuses to attract new players. Common incentives include welcome deposit matches, freerolls, or bonus chips that can boost your bankroll early on. It’s important to read the terms and conditions, including wagering requirements, to understand how and when you can withdraw winnings derived from bonuses.
Regular Promotions and Special Tournaments
Ongoing promotions can provide additional value for loyal players. These may include sit-and-go tournaments, leaderboard contests, or cashback offers. High-stakes players might also find exclusive high-roller tournaments or VIP programs designed to reward consistent play with perks such as faster withdrawals, personal account managers, or unique tournament entries.

Important Considerations for Online Poker Players
Player Protection and Responsible Gambling
Good platforms implement tools to promote responsible gambling, such as deposit limits, self-exclusion, and time tracking. Always set personal limits and play within your means to avoid developing gambling problems.
Legality and Local Regulations
Before registering, ensure that online poker is legal in your jurisdiction. While many platforms accept players worldwide, some regions have restrictions regarding remote gambling. It’s your responsibility to stay informed about local laws to avoid any legal issues.
Transparency and Customer Support
An honest platform provides clear terms of service, transparent payout policies, and accessible customer support channels (live chat, email, phone). Responsive support can be invaluable if you encounter technical issues or disputes.
